How to send a payment request
Select your channel
Choose the channel you want to send the payment request through (SMS, email, WhatsApp, Instagram, or Facebook).
Click the dollar sign icon
Click the $ (dollar sign) icon in the message toolbar to open the payment request panel.

Fill in the invoice details
Complete the fields in the payment request dialog:
- Product or service name — what you are charging for
- Amount — the dollar amount to collect
- Currency — defaults to your account currency
- Description (optional) — additional context for the contact
Copy or send the link
- Click Copy Link to paste the payment link into your message manually.
- Or click Send to insert the payment link directly into the message box.
Supported channels
Payment requests can be sent through any channel where the dollar sign icon appears:| Channel | Payment request supported |
|---|---|
| SMS | Yes |
| Yes | |
| Yes | |
| Instagram DM | Yes |
| Facebook Messenger | Yes |
| Web Chat Widget | Yes |
How it works for the contact
When your contact receives the message, they see a payment link. Clicking it opens a secure hosted checkout page where they can enter their card details and complete the payment. You receive a notification when payment is completed, and the contact’s record is updated automatically.
Tracking payment status
After sending a payment request:- An Activity Card appears in the conversation thread showing the invoice status.
- When the contact pays, the status updates to Paid and a new Activity Card is logged.
- You can also view all payment activity in the Payments tab of the contact record.
Can I send multiple payment requests in the same conversation?
Can I send multiple payment requests in the same conversation?
Yes. Each payment request generates its own unique link. You can send as many as needed in a single conversation, and each is tracked separately.
What payment processors are supported?
What payment processors are supported?
Payment collection relies on your connected payment processor (Stripe, PayPal, or another supported integration). Configure your payment integration in Settings → Payments before sending payment requests.
Can the contact pay later?
Can the contact pay later?
Yes. The payment link stays active until the invoice is paid or manually voided. Contacts can open it at any time from any device.
Is there a fee for using payment requests in conversations?
Is there a fee for using payment requests in conversations?
Standard payment processor fees apply. HoopAI does not charge an additional fee for sending payment requests through conversations.
.png?fit=max&auto=format&n=EQK5eX9kTD8NzWwA&q=85&s=878008bf159fcc4964d0c0d508b6e400)